Weathering the storm starts with regular roof inspections. Periodic checks can help identify any potential weaknesses or damages before they evolve into more significant issues. During these inspections, look for missing or damaged shingles, signs of leakage, and any anomalies that may require attention. A vital component of maintaining your roof's durability is gutter maintenance. While gutters may seem unrelated, they play an essential role in directing rainfall away from your home. Clogged gutters can lead to water accumulation and eventually cause roof damage or basement flooding. Regularly cleaning your gutters, especially before the onset of rainy seasons, ensures proper water flow and reduces the risk of damage.

Proper attic ventilation is another key factor that is often overlooked. Effective ventilation regulates temperature and moisture levels, which prevents mold growth and structural damage. In winter, inadequate ventilation can lead to ice dam formation, causing water to seep under shingles and into your home. Ensuring your attic has sufficient ventilation is an easy yet impactful step in extending your roof's lifespan.

When considering long-term solutions for roof durability, think about the materials used. Different materials have varying lifespans and resilience to weather conditions. Asphalt shingles are cost-effective and popular, but options like metal roofing offer higher durability and better protection against extreme weather. Another preventive measure to consider is trimming nearby trees. Overhanging branches pose a significant threat, especially during high winds or storms. Falling branches can puncture your roof or cause prolonged damage. Regularly trim back branches to minimize risks and ensure they are at a safe distance from your roofline.

In the wake of a heavy storm, quick assessment and repair of any damage are critical. The sooner damage is addressed, the less likely it is to escalate into more severe problems. Delaying repairs can lead to increased moisture ingress, structural damage, and higher costs.
